As scientists and certain social scientists find themselves accessing information resources without the intermediation of the library, how does this affect their perceptions of the library and future prospects for the library’s campus role? Ithaka’s 2006 surveys of US faculty members and librarians indicate that faculty members’ views of the library, and the value they place in library services, has changed significantly in recent years. This talk will examine the strategic implications to libraries and universities more broadly that emerge from faculty attitudes and perspectives on libraries and their value, including specific library functions, and how these perceptions are changing.
